In the ever-evolving landscape of business finance, entrepreneurs are constantly seeking innovative ways to fund their ventures. One such method gaining traction is the concept of a **loan against profits**. This financial strategy allows businesses to leverage their future earnings as collateral, providing a unique opportunity to access funds without the traditional constraints of securing loans against physical assets.

#### Understanding Loan Against Profits

A **loan against profits** is essentially a financing option where lenders evaluate a business's projected profits to determine the loan amount. This approach is particularly advantageous for companies that may not have substantial physical assets but possess strong revenue potential. By using anticipated earnings as collateral, businesses can unlock capital that can be reinvested into operations, marketing, or expansion efforts.

#### How to Secure a Loan Against Profits

1. **Prepare Financial Statements**: To apply for a **loan against profits**, businesses must present detailed financial statements, including profit and loss statements, cash flow projections, and balance sheets. Lenders will assess these documents to gauge the company's profitability and future earnings potential.

2. **Develop a Solid Business Plan**: A comprehensive business plan that outlines how the funds will be utilized can enhance the chances of securing a loan. Lenders want to see a clear strategy for growth and how the borrowed funds will contribute to that vision.

3. **Research Lenders**: Not all lenders offer loans against profits, so it's essential to conduct thorough research. Look for financial institutions or alternative lenders that specialize in this type of financing and understand the unique needs of your business.

4. **Negotiate Terms**: Once a lender is identified, be prepared to negotiate terms. Understand the interest rates, repayment schedules, and any fees associated with the loan. A clear understanding of these factors will help in making an informed decision.
